FRESNO, Calif. – Fresno Pacific’s chance at their first swimming and diving national title has become more realistic this season as the Sunbirds will send divers to Nationals for the first time in program history.  Two men, Dan Crosby and Zach Niles, and one woman, Amanda Plymette, will represent Fresno Pacific in St. Louis.

RIVERSIDE, Calif. – With a little more than a month to go before Nationals, the Sunbirds got a preview of some of the other best swimmers in the NAIA.  Both men and women Sunbirds are ranked No. 1 in the nation, but were challenged as the women fell to both No. 4 California Baptist and No. 5 Concordia, while the men split defeating No. 2 Concordia but falling to defending national champions No. 4 California Baptist.  The Sunbirds took eleven events including three of the four relays, but it wasn’t enough for the outright victory.

Fresno Pacific swimming is beginning their third season in a new spot for their program: at the top.  Both men’s and women’s teams were announced as No. 1 in the season’s first poll.  The men took three of the four first-place votes while the women took two.

LONG BEACH, Calif. – Fresno Pacific continues to race with tough competitors, taking on team like UC Santa Barbara, UNLV and Cal Poly at the Finis Cup this last weekend on Dec. 11 through Dec. 14.  The Sunbirds finished the weekend with six top-eight individual finishers and three relays finishing in the top-three.

FRESNO, Calif. – Fresno Pacific swimming and diving hit the pool this weekend with a double-dual meet with UC Santa Cruz and University of Pacific.  The men and women’s outcomes were different, but both squads swam well.  The women fell short in both meets losing to NCAA Div. III UC Santa Cruz 119-180 and NCAA Div. I University of Pacific 107-177.  The men defeated Santa Cruz 197-101 and Pacific 172-116.

OAKLAND, Calif. – Fresno Pacific women’s swimming finished a strong weekend at the Bay Area Invitational against four other women’s squads taking every event on Friday and finishing the weekend with 17 victories, including all five relays.

DAVIS, Calif. – Fresno Pacific men’s swimming had a big task in their first dual meet of the season against a strong NCAA Div. I UC Davis squad.  The Sunbirds took six events on the day while the Aggies finished with ten victories.  The Sunbirds fell 125-167.

FRESNO, Calif. – Fresno Pacific women came out ready for redemption after falling to Fresno State in their last duel meet, and showed their strength winning 10 of the 13 events on the day against East Bay.  The Sunbirds took the meet convincingly 140-83.
